Seminar: Microclimate Change: The Hidden driver of species redistribution 

Friday, May 24th 2024, 13:00 - 14:00, Orion B4044 + B4045

Dr. Jonas Lembrechts

Assistant Professor in Ecological Scaling

Utrecht University, The Netherlands

Recent research has shown that the impacts of climate change on terrestrial species distributions are more complex than expected. Species distributions are showing significant delays in responses, or have shifted in unexpected directions. Scientists have identified several mechanisms that could explain these mismatches, including slow population dynamics, habitat fragmentation, and biotic interactions that limit the spread of species. Yet, one crucial aspect remains largely overlooked: we first need relevant high-resolution baseline climate change data to accurately answer this question.

Indeed, organisms respond to microclimate change, which can differ significantly from macroclimate change. We know that local temperatures near the ground or below vegetation can be several degrees different from weather station data. However, it remains a mystery how quickly these microclimates are changing, as this depends as much on climate change as on land use changes.

In this talk, we will explore how the SoilTemp-database, a global database of more than 100,000 in-situ measured microclimate time series, can be used to improve global microclimate products and ultimately provide better estimates of microclimate change. By applying these products to improve our ecological models, from species distributions over disease prediction to decomposition, we can better understand the impacts of climate change on biodiversity and ecosystem functioning, crucial for adjusting biodiversity management to a rapidly changing world.

Workshop: Tips and tricks to optimize your own local microclimate or environmental monitoring

Friday, May 24th 2024, 10:00 - 11:30, Orion B4042

Effective microclimate monitoring requires putting microclimate on the forefront. Up till now, many on-the-ground observations are still an afterthought of more ‘important’ ecological questions, and such ad-hoc sensor deployments may fail to capture the environmental heterogeneity one is interested in. In this workshop, Dr. Lembrechts will summarize the recent (unpublished) efforts by the SoilTemp-network to create standardized - yet flexible - workflows to design microclimate networks, targeting academic and applied ecologists interested in biodiversity conservation, natural resource management, and climate adaptation.

 Drawing on years of experience with networks from across the globe (from a 5000-strong citizen science network in Flanders to a nation-wide network in Oman or local networks on a remote sub-Antarctic island), the workshop covers everything from location and sensor selection, over spatiotemporal resolution to the practicalities of sensor deployment in the field and in pots, and stakeholder engagement. By addressing these known and unknown challenges in sensor deployment, this workshop aims to enhance the utility and robustness of microclimate (and other environmental) monitoring efforts.

There will be plenty of room for discussing particular case studies, questions and issues as experienced by the participants, working towards practical solutions to optimize your own microclimate data collection.

Seminar: Mate choice, extra-pair paternity and social networks (16.00h in C1005, Orion)

Dr. Julia Schroeder

Senior Lecturer

Imperial College London, UK

Female mate choice is one of the hallmarks of sexual selection. Driven by anisogamy, females are predicted to be the choosier sex, selecting her mates by aiming to maximise the quality of her offspring, while males are predicted to favour quantity over quality. Extra-pair paternity in socially monogamous song birds is a model system where this female choice is put under magnification: females exchange the genetic contribution of the father, but the rest stays the same. This system allows us to test several predictions from sexual selection and beyond. Here I will explore the classical sexual selection hypotheses (good genes, sexy sons), more recent suggestions (pleiotropy hypotheses) and the roles of ageing, opportunity and connectedness in mate choice. I will present data from 25 years of research in our island system of house sparrows.

Using fitness landscapes to engineer microbial communities

(16:00 - Orion C2035)

Dr. Djordje Bajić

Assistant Professor, Industrial Microbiology

Department of Biotechnology

TU Delft

Microbial communities hold great promise as sustainable alternative in many biotechnological, agricultural and environmental applications. However, the functions and services that microbial communities provide depend on an intricate network of interactions between species and their environment. This makes engineering microbial communities a remarkably challenging task. One of the main interests of my group is to address this challenge by developing predictive models that link the composition of a community to its function. In this seminar, I will start by extending the concept of fitness landscapes to explore maps between microbial community composition and function. Then, I will discuss some exciting recent developments in which we leveraged this approach for engineering microbial communities.

Seminar (16:00-17:00 - Orion C1005)

Evolution of brood parasitism in the cuckoo catfish
Prof. Martin Reichard
Professor at the Czech Academy of Sciences, Institute of Vertebrate Biology
  

Interspecific brood parasitism is a reproductive strategy whereby biological parents allocate their parental duties to a different species. I will address various aspects of ecology and evolution of brood parasitism in fishes, with special focus on the cuckoo catfish (Synodontis multipunctatus), a brood parasite of mouth-brooding cichlids in the African Lake Tanganyika. I will use a comparative approach to demonstrate how (dis)similar the cuckoo catfish is compared to other Synodontis catfishes in Lake Tanganyika and what this means for the origin of brood parasitism. I will then compare the role of coevolution and learning on the success of cichlid hosts to avoid parasitism by cuckoo catfish and also explain how cuckoo catfish learn to parasitize more effectively as they gain experience. I also address the potential for and constraints on host specialization and research into the origins of this reproductive strategy, using a combination of data collected in the field and laboratory experiments.

Seminar (16:00-17:00 - Orion C1005)

Coral reef fishes as a model to understand animal societies

 
Dr. Theresa Rueger
Lecturer, Tropical Marine Biology
Newcastle University, UK
 
The evolution of complex groups, where some individuals reproduce and others do not, remains an evolutionary mystery for many animal species, including marine fishes. Anemonefishes and gobies, model organisms for the ecology and evolution of marine organisms, live in complex groups with two dominant breeders and several non-breeding subordinates. We know why subordinates accept their situation: limited habitat availability and high predation rate associated with movement between groups create harsh ecological constraints; and strict size hierarchies and the threat of eviction create harsh social constraints. However, we do not know why dominant breeders accept subordinates to share their resources. We tested several classic hypotheses to explain social evolution in coral reef fishes: 1) The kin selection hypothesis; 2) the mate-replacement hypothesis and 3) the pay-to-stay hypothesis. We used genetics, experiments and behavioural observations on anemonefish and goby populations in Papua New Guinea. We found that 1) surprisingly, despite a larval dispersal phase, relatedness in groups of coral reef fishes can be significantly higher than the population mean; 2) the variance, but not the mean, of time to replace a mate is reduced when subordinates are present; and 3) subordinates perform helping behaviours beneficial to the dominants, often mediated by their anemone or coral mutualistic hosts. None of these factors alone can explain the formation and maintenance of groups in coral reef fishes, but added together a clear picture emerges of why dominant breeders accept subordinates to form complex societies.

Seminar: The reshaping of ecological communities globally under land-use change and climate change (October 17th 2023, 16h-17h in Orion, C3033)

Dr. Tim Newbold

Principal Research Fellow

Genetics, Evolution & Environment

University College London, United Kingdom

Biodiversity is changing rapidly under the influence of human actions. Until now, land-use change has been the predominant driver of biodiversity change, but the impact of climate change is now clear and accelerating. Using global biodiversity data and models, my research seeks to understand how land-use change, climate change and their interactions are restructuring ecological communities worldwide. I also explore which types of species are benefiting and losing from land-use and climate changes, and what this means for human societies because of changes in pollinator biodiversity.

Seminar: Voyage of the Starships: Horizontal gene transfer of giant transposons drives adaptation across fungi (September 28th 2023, 16.00h in Orion, B4044)

Dr. Aaron Vogan

Independent Researcher,

Institute of Organismal Biology,

Uppsala University, Sweden

Transposable elements in eukaryotic organisms are often regarded as “selfish,” typically providing only indirect benefits to their host organisms. A novel discovery in fungal genomes is the presence of Starships, which display characteristics of transposable elements and are believed to confer advantageous traits to their hosts at certain instances. During the seminar, Dr. Aaron will delve into the subject of Starships exploring their involvement in mobilizing into specific genomic sites and their role in multiple recent instances of horizontal gene transfers.

 Seminar: Beetle perspectives on eating cabbage: how multitrophic interactions have shaped flea beetle adaptations to glucosinolates (16.00h in Orion, C2030)

Dr. Franziska Beran

Project manager, Department of Insect Symbiosis

Max Planck Institute for Chemical Ecology, Jena, Germany  

Most herbivorous insect species are specialists that feed on only a small number of plant species. These food preferences are strongly influenced by plant defense compounds to which insects have adapted. Insects employ remarkably diverse strategies to cope with plant defense compounds, ranging from enzymatic breakdown to sequestration, the accumulation of plant toxins for protection from natural enemies. Our goal is to understand the impact of functionally different adaptations to plant defense compounds on the ecology and evolution of herbivorous insects. Therefore, we focus on two closely related genera of flea beetles that have independently from each other specialized on brassicaceous plant and either detoxify or sequester glucosinolates, the characteristic defense compounds of Brassicaceae. By combining metabolomic and transcriptomic approaches with functional and phylogenetic studies, we investigate the molecular basis and evolution of flea beetle adaptations to glucosinolates. Our results reveal how plants and natural enemies have shaped the adaptive strategies of flea beetles and provide insights into factors contributing to the evolutionary success of these insects. I will also discuss the implications of our findings for the development of sustainable pest control strategies.  

Workshop: Plant secondary metabolites and the evolution of insect-plant interaction (14.00h in Orion, B4015)

Insect-plant associations are often regarded as the result of a coevolutionary arms race that has been driven by the diversification plant defense compounds and corresponding insect counteradaptations. In this workshop we will take advantage of a classical model system in this field, the interaction between Pieridae butterflies and their Brassicales host plants to discuss the concept of coevolution and the possible role of insect adaptations to plant defense compounds as evolutionary key innovations.

Seminar: Climate, nutrients, and herbivores shape Earth’s grasslands, but can kangaroos, kudus, and cows keep up on our changing planet? (16.00h in Orion, C2035)  

Prof. Elizabeth Borer

Professor of Ecology, Evolution and Behaviour

University of Minnesota

Changing climate poses such existential challenges that we often equate global change with climate change. But while predicting and mitigating climate change impacts is critically important, climate is only one of many ongoing global changes shaping the ecology of current and future Earth. In less than a century, human activities have more than doubled the amount of reactive nitrogen supplied to Earth’s ecosystems, and humans are causing extinctions and invasions of plant and animal species. Understanding the conditions under which these concurrent changes may amplify or mitigate impacts on plant and animal biodiversity and the functioning of ecosystems is among the greatest current challenges for ecology. I will synthesize results arising a globally distributed, collaborative network of identically replicated grassland experiments, the Nutrient Network, and will present a cross-section of the network’s insights into the role of climate in shaping how mammalian herbivores and nutrients control plant and animal biodiversity and ecosystem processes in the world’s grassland ecosystems.

Workshop: Nitrogen, climate, and ecosystem functioning in the Netherlands – and the rest of the world  (14.00h in Orion, B3042) 

Prof. Elizabeth Borer

Professor of Ecology, Evolution and Behaviour

University of Minnesota

The Dutch government is taking measures to reduce nitrogen deposition and carbon emissions with the goal of ‘improving the quality of nature’ in the country and meeting climate obligations. Often, the impacts of climate and nitrogen deposition are considered separately, yet there is increasing evidence that these global changes act together to cause unexpected outcomes for the functioning of ecosystems. We’ll discuss the state of science on this topic, with a focus on grasslands, and consider where and when these and other global changes are most likely to impact ecosystems.

Seminar: In your face: exploring morphology, evolution and development of the skull (16.00h in Orion, C3033)

Dr. Arkhat Abzhanov

Reader in Evolution and Developmental Genetics

Imperial College London, UK

Understanding the origins of morphological variation is one of the chief challenges to the modern biological sciences. Cranial diversity in vertebrates is a particularly inviting research topic as animal heads and faces show many dramatic and unique adaptive features which reflect their natural history. We aim to reveal molecular mechanisms underlying evolutionary processes that generate such morphological variation. To this purpose, we employ a synergistic combination of geometric morphometrics, comparative molecular embryology and functional experimentation methods to trace cranial evolution in reptiles, birds and mammals, some of the most charismatic animals on our planet.  Our research is revealing how particular changes in developmental genetics can produce morphological alterations for natural selection to act upon, for example in generating adaptive radiations.

Workshop: From field to lab and back: exploring non-model organisms (14.00h in Forum, B0408)

Working on non-model organisms can offer valuable ecological and evolutionary insights but also presents novel challenges for researchers. In this workshop, we will consider the benefits and challenges of working on evolutionary non-model species, with discussions spanning from morphology to mechanism and from nature/museums to the lab.
